Ewes handled roughly too close to lambing time may lamb prematurely. ... Producers not shearing should at least crutch their ewes prior to lambing. Crutching is the shearing of wool from around the dock and udder. Crutched ewes are more sanitary and easier to handle at lambing time. It is also easier for newborn lambs...

The Department of Agriculture, Food and Rural Development and the Department of Health and Children today issued advice to pregnant women to avoid contact with sheep at lambing time. This advice was issued in the context of the potential risks that exist of contracting an infection which can occur in some ewes.
